Fine Napkin Ring Birmingham 1912 By John Rose.

Status: This item has been sold
Sold by: Woodbridge Antiques

A lovely napkin ring. Lovely plain polished silver with a protruding beaded edge to both the top and bottom. On one side are the clear hallmarks for the Birmingham Assay Office with a date mark for 1912 and Lion Passant indicating the finest sterling silver. The silvermaker''s marks are also visible for John Rose.
 
This napkin has a lovely clean crisp and stylish appearance!
 
 
 
Condition: In lovely antique condition.
 
 
 
Hallmarks and maker''s marks: Birmingham 1912 by John Rose
 
 
 
Measurements:
 
Height: 2 cm approx.
 
Diameter width: 4.4 cm approx.
 
Weight: 17.7 grams approx.
